/ Forside / Teknologi / Udvikling / SQL /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
SQL
#NavnPoint
pmbruun 1704
niller 962
fehaar 730
Interkril.. 701
ellebye 510
pawel 510
rpje 405
pete 350
gibson 320
10  smorch 260
søg i database
Fra : pepss


Dato : 24-11-03 14:43

Hejsa NG

jeg vil lave en søgning i en MySQL database.
søgningen skal være "find alle" eller "find dem med feltnavn =Null" eller "
find alle hvor feltnavn ikke er Null"
jeg er ikke kommet så meget længer ind:

<input type="radio" name="test" value="1" />ja <input type="radio"
name="test" value="NULL" />nej</p>



strtest = Request.Form("test")

If NOT Len(strtest)>0 Then
strtest = "%"
End If

strSQL = "Select * From table Where feltnavn LIKE '" & strtest & "' "

det gør jo så ikke men jeg kan bare ikke lige se hvordan man kan gøre
det....
håber der er nogen der kan komme med nogle guldkorn!

--
pepss
den ordblinde der prøver at blive web-designer
www.cafe-flirt.dk
www.team-blitz.dk



 
 
Jesper Stocholm (25-11-2003)
Kommentar
Fra : Jesper Stocholm


Dato : 25-11-03 10:11

pepss wrote :

> Hejsa NG
>
> jeg vil lave en søgning i en MySQL database.

> søgningen skal være "find alle"

SELECT * FROM Table1

> eller "find dem med feltnavn =Null"

SELECT * FROM Table1 WHERE feltnavn is null

> eller " find alle hvor feltnavn ikke er Null"

SELECT * FROM Table1 WHERE feltnavn is not null


--
Jesper Stocholm
http://stocholm.dk
Give a man a fish and he will have food for a day,
give a man an elephant, and he will have food for a week.

pepss (25-11-2003)
Kommentar
Fra : pepss


Dato : 25-11-03 15:24


"Jesper Stocholm" skrev
> pepss wrote :

> > jeg vil lave en søgning i en MySQL database.
>
> > søgningen skal være "find alle"
>
> SELECT * FROM Table1
>
> > eller "find dem med feltnavn =Null"
>
> SELECT * FROM Table1 WHERE feltnavn is null
>
> > eller " find alle hvor feltnavn ikke er Null"
>
> SELECT * FROM Table1 WHERE feltnavn is not null

så langt så godt men jeg vil gerne ha den til at gøre det ud fra hvad
brugerne søger efter og jeg kan ikke bare lave en if for det er en søgning
sammen med en massen andre søgekriterier


--
pepss
den ordblinde der prøver at blive web-designer
www.cafe-flirt.dk
www.team-blitz.dk



Jens Gyldenkærne Cla~ (24-11-2003)
Kommentar
Fra : Jens Gyldenkærne Cla~


Dato : 24-11-03 15:48

pepss skrev:

> søgningen skal være "find alle" eller "find dem med feltnavn
> =Null" eller " find alle hvor feltnavn ikke er Null"

Her skal du vide at Null er en specialværdi, der i søgninger
angives således:

WHERE foo IS NULL /* (find poster hvor foo er null) */

WHERE foo IS NOT NULL /* poster hvor foo ikke er null */


> <input type="radio" name="test" value="1" />ja <input
> type="radio" name="test" value="NULL" />nej</p>

Hvis du har radioknapper, skal de hedde det samme for at fungere
som du (formentlig) forventer.


> strSQL = "Select * From table Where feltnavn LIKE '" & strtest
> & "' "

Operatorerne = og LIKE kan som nævnt ikke benyttes med NULL - brug
IS NULL hhv. IS NOT NULL
--
Jens Gyldenkærne Clausen
»Diplomatiet består netop i, at de gamle kommatister kan få lov til
at tro, at de har vundet. Men i virkeligheden har de tabt.«
Ole Togeby i Information

pepss (25-11-2003)
Kommentar
Fra : pepss


Dato : 25-11-03 15:21


"Jens Gyldenkærne Clausen" skrev
> pepss skrev:
>
> > søgningen skal være "find alle" eller "find dem med feltnavn
> > =Null" eller " find alle hvor feltnavn ikke er Null"
>
>
> > <input type="radio" name="test" value="1" />ja <input
> > type="radio" name="test" value="NULL" />nej</p>
>
> Hvis du har radioknapper, skal de hedde det samme for at fungere
> som du (formentlig) forventer.

det gør de da også! name="test"

> > strSQL = "Select * From table Where feltnavn LIKE '" & strtest
> > & "' "
>
> Operatorerne = og LIKE kan som nævnt ikke benyttes med NULL - brug
> IS NULL hhv. IS NOT NULL

hmmm så er mit problem ikke blevet binder.....

problemet er jo at jeg ikke ved hvad brugerne vil søge efter....
det felt jeg vil søge i er et "foto" felt som standart er NULL men når man
så oploader et billede kommer stien så i.
derfor ved jeg jo ikke hvad der stå i feltet det kan jo være
"billede1234.jpg" eller hvad ved jeg.
når man så vil søge i feltet er det så planen at man skal kunne søge efter
om der er noget i feltet......

håber det er til at forstå hvad jeg mener

--
pepss
den ordblinde der prøver at blive web-designer
www.cafe-flirt.dk
www.team-blitz.dk



Søg
Reklame
Statistik
Spørgsmål : 177558
Tips : 31968
Nyheder : 719565
Indlæg : 6408925
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ste